▎ 摘 要
NOVELTY - The method involves coating graphene oxide solution on an organic film. Polymer electrolyte is coated on a negative electrode and a pole ear of a graphene battery and positioned X and Y axis-planes addressing. Positive electrode material is coated on a solid polymer electrolyte. The battery is irradiated with high-energy rays through X and Y-axis planes addressing and positioning according to shape of the battery for cleaning excess positive electrode material and drying to obtain a battery positive electrode. Winding and cutting operations of the organic film are performed according to the shape of the graphene battery for riveting and packaging the electrode. USE - Electrode-less ear graphene battery assembling method. ADVANTAGE - The method enables simultaneously manufacturing multiple graphene batteries under environment-friendly condition and without adding toxic reducing agent, assembling lug and back electrode to simplify battery structure for reducing processing procedure, ensuring simple operation and high working efficiency.
